Union Railway Minister Ashwini Vaishnaw announced India’s first bullet train, the Surat to Bilimora stretch, will be operational by 2027, highlighting significant progress on tracks and stations. New technologies are being implemented, and the Surat station features passenger comfort, connectivity, and sustainability. The Mumbai-Ahmedabad corridor is also advancing steadily with substantial infrastructure work completed.

What Makes This Bullet Train So Special?

The planned Shinkansen E5 series trains, based on Japanese technology, are designed for speeds of up to 320 km/h, drastically cutting travel time. They are renowned for their safety, reliability, and passenger comfort. The trains are engineered to provide a smooth, quiet ride, even at top speed, ensuring a pleasurable journey for passengers.

Beyond the trains themselves, the entire system is designed for efficiency and safety. Advanced signaling systems, automated train control, and rigorous safety protocols are all integral parts of the design. The goal is not just to move people quickly, but to move them safely and reliably.

Challenges and the Road Ahead

Of course, a project of this scale is not without its challenges. Land acquisition, environmental concerns, and the sheer complexity of the engineering involved all present significant hurdles. The project has faced delays, and cost overruns are always a possibility. However, the commitment from both the Indian and Japanese governments remains strong, and progress is being made steadily.

The completion of the Surat-Bilimora section is a testament to the perseverance and dedication of the teams involved. It provides a crucial learning experience and helps build confidence for the remaining phases of the project.
